Head to Nevis Range and take a gondola ride for breathtaking views of Ben Nevis, the highest mountain in the UK. You can also enjoy hiking trails or mountain biking.
Nevis Range is a short drive from Fort William town centre, follow signs for the gondola station.
End your day with a seafood dinner at The Crannog, a unique restaurant built on stilts over the water. Taste fresh seafood dishes while enjoying the tranquil Loch Linnhe views.
Located on the waterfront in Fort William, immerse yourself in the charming ambience.
Embark on a challenging hike up Ben Nevis, the highest peak in the UK. Experience stunning views from the summit, a rewarding accomplishment for outdoor enthusiasts.
Start the hike from the Glen Nevis Visitor Centre, follow marked trails to reach the summit.
After the hike, unwind at Neptune's Staircase, a series of locks on the Caledonian Canal. Watch boats navigate the canal while enjoying the peaceful surroundings.
A short drive from Fort William, follow signs to Neptune's Staircase.

Embark on a scenic cruise on Loch Lomond. Relax on the boat and admire the beauty of the largest lake in Scotland, surrounded by picturesque landscapes.
Head to the nearest pier and book a cruise around Loch Lomond for a memorable experience.

Explore the stunning landscapes of Loch Lomond & The Trossachs National Park. Choose from various hiking trails to discover waterfalls, forests, and wildlife.
Drive to the park's visitor centre and select a hiking trail that suits your preferences.
